Information about Earth's core mostly comes from analysis of seismic waves and Earth's magnetic field.
Earth was discovered to have a solid inner core distinct from its molten outer core in 1936, by the Danish seismologist Inge Lehmann, who deduced its presence by studying seismograms from earthquakes in New Zealand.
She observed that the seismic waves reflect off the boundary of the inner core and can be detected by sensitive seismographs on the Earth's surface.
Almost all direct measurements that scientists have about the physical properties of the inner core are the seismic waves that pass through it.
The most informative waves are generated by deep earthquakes, 30"nbsp;km or more below the surface of the Earth (where the mantle is relatively more homogeneous) and recorded by seismographs as they reach the surface, all over the globe.
On the basis of the seismic data, the inner core is estimated to be about 1221"nbsp;km in radius (2442"nbsp;km in diameter);, which is about 19% of the radius of the Earth and 70% of the radius of the Moon.
